From Nevada Evening Journal September 4, 1950 (page 3)

Last Rites For Dan Wear, Collins

Funeral services for the late Daniel D. Wear were held last Thursday afternoon Aug. 24, at 2 o'clock at the home, in charge of the Rev. Henry Esch of Garden City, Minn., former pastor of the Collins Church of Christ.

Vocal music was a trio composed of Mrs. K. W. Tomlinson, Mrs. B. J. Caulkins and Miss Calla Wood, who sang "Be Still My Soul" and "Beyond the Sunset", accompanied by Mrs. Fred Mead on the accordion.

The flowers were cared for by Mrs. Ora Hanson, Mrs. Hugh Fertig and Mrs. C. R. Stone.

Casket bearers were O. A. Caulkins, B. J. Caulkins, E. W. Swanson, Keith Swanson, Glen Mitchell and Stanley Mitchell. Interment was in Collins Evergreen cemetery.

Obituary

Daniel D. Wear was born May 24, 1890, in Illinois, where he grew to manhood, coming to Nevada, Iowa, with a construction crew during the building of the Circle theater.

In the fall of 1931, Dan came to Collins and operated a portable mill. On June 16, 1935, he was united in marriage to Miss Mercie Purviance. He continued with his milling business for a number of years, while Mrs. Wear also continued her work at the Exchange State Bank in Collins. Later, they engaged in farming, which occupation he followed and enjoyed until his death.

He passed away on the afternoon of August 21, 1950, aged 60 years, two months and 27 days, death being caused by a cerebral hemorrhage.

Survivors

He leaves to mourn his sudden death his wife, Mercie; and his father-in-law and mother-in-law, Mr. and Mrs. Plummer Purviance, is well as many friends.

Friends and relatives were present from Des Moines, Diagonal, Shannon City, Afton, Corydon, Newton, Glidden, Carlisle, Maxwell, Colo, State Center, Baxter, Mason City, Tingley, Clear Lake, Manly, Ventura and Prescott, Arizona.
